FAIR WORK REGULATIONS 2009 - REG 1.12

Meaning of pieceworker

  (1)   For paragraph   21(1)(c) of the Act, this regulation prescribes a class of award/agreement free employees as pieceworkers.

Note:   Under paragraph   21(1)(c) of the Act, a pieceworker is an award/agreement free employee who is in a class of employees prescribed by the regulations as pieceworkers.

  (2)   The class is award/agreement free employees who:

  (a)   are paid a rate set by reference to a quantifiable output or task; and

  (b)   are not paid a rate set by reference to a period of time worked.

Examples of rates set by reference to a quantifiable output or task

1   A rate of pay calculated by reference to the number of articles produced.

2   A rate of pay calculated by reference to the number of kilometres travelled.

3   A rate of pay calculated by reference to the number of articles delivered.

4   A rate of pay calculated by reference to the number of articles sold.

5   A rate of pay calculated by reference to the number of tasks performed.
